Manor Farm, 3 Orlingbury Road, Great Harrowden, Wellingborough, Northamptonshire, United Kingdom, NN9 5AF
The Orchards, 1a Orlingbury Road, Great Harrowden, Wellingborough, Northamptonshire, NN9 5AF
The Orchards, 1a Orlingbury Road, Great Harrowden, Wellingborough, Northamptonshire, NN9 5AF
Bradan House, 1b Orlingbury Road, Gt Harrowden, Northamptonshire, NN9 5AF
Manor Farm, 3 Orlingbury Road, Great Harrowden, Wellingborough, Northamptonshire, United Kingdom, NN9 5AF
The Old Vicarage, Great Harrowden, Northamptonshire, England, NN9 5AF
Popular Companies
Copyright © 2024. All rights reserved.